Alternatively, from Pierre Lebrun:
Barry Trotz had a clause in his contract where if he won the Stanley Cup he could accept a two-year extension with a $300k bump in salary. Obviously since he was only making $1.5M, low by today's NHL coach's standards, a $1.8-million salary doesn't cut it. So Trotz stepped down.
So the Caps may not have wanted to pay him, he may want longer term, or he's simply retiring.
